Enhancing Commercial Property Performance

Commercial property acquisition requires a strategic and dynamic approach to maximize profitability. By implementing best practices in administration, owners can increase the value of their assets. This includes a multifaceted strategy that focuses on several key areas. First, it's crucial to conduct thorough analysis to identify current trends. This insight can guide decisions regarding pricing.

Furthermore, regular servicing is essential to maintain the integrity of the property. By proactively addressing any repairs, owners can avoid costly disruptions.

Moreover, creating a welcoming tenant environment is crucial for retaining quality tenants. This can involve implementing amenities, handling maintenance requests promptly, and fostering a feeling of community. Finally, responsiveness is key in the ever-evolving real estate landscape. Investors should be ready to modify their strategies to accommodate changing market conditions.

Commercial Real Estate Asset Management

Strategic commercial real estate asset management entails a comprehensive and dynamic approach to maximize value over the lifecycle of a property. It incorporates a multifaceted spectrum of activities, including operational analysis, occupancy management, property disposition, and capital mitigation.

Through meticulous foresight, skilled asset managers identify opportunities to elevate income, reduce expenses, and augment the overall desirability of an asset.

A well-executed asset management plan adjusts to evolving market trends and owner objectives, ultimately generating sustained growth in the competitive realm of commercial real estate.

Maximizing ROI in Commercial Real Estate Investment

Securing a profitable return on your commercial real estate investment necessitates careful planning and strategic execution.

To maximize ROI, consider these key factors: location selection, tenant profile analysis, sector trends research, and a robust due diligence process.

Constructing your property with sustainable practices can Check out this link entice environmentally conscious tenants while reducing operational costs in the long run.

Regularly evaluate market conditions and adjust your leasing strategy to leverage emerging opportunities.

Utilize technology solutions to streamline property management tasks, reduce vacancy rates, and optimize tenant satisfaction. Remember, a well-maintained and desirable property can attain higher rental rates and increase its overall value.

Building Strong Tenant Relationships

Cultivating positive relationships with tenants is paramount for the prosperity of any commercial property. To achieve maximum tenancy duration, landlords and property managers must implement strategic initiatives that prioritize tenants' expectations.

A holistic approach should encompass frequent communication, prompt response to concerns, and a commitment to enhancing the tenant experience.

Consider implementing amenities that appeal to tenants, including fitness centers, coworking spaces, or accessible parking. {Furthermore|Moreover, it's crucial to cultivate a sense of community within the property by hosting activities. By valuing tenant satisfaction, landlords can build lasting partnerships that contribute to the long-term profitability of their commercial properties.

Cutting-Edge Technologies Transforming Commercial Property Management

The commercial property management industry is undergoing a dramatic evolution, driven by innovative technologies that are revolutionizing operations and maximizing tenant experiences. From intelligent building systems to data-driven analytics platforms, these advancements are facilitating property managers to adjust to the dynamic demands of the modern real estate landscape. Software-as-a-Service solutions are aggregating data from various sources, providing valuable intelligence for making informed decisions about property maintenance, tenant engagement, and overall portfolio strategy.

  • Artificial learning algorithms are streamlining repetitive tasks such as lease administration and maintenance, freeing up valuable time for property managers to focus on more demanding initiatives.
  • Sensor Networks are playing a key role in creating intelligent buildings that can analyze energy consumption, security systems, and other critical aspects of building functionality, leading to increased cost savings.
  • Mixed Reality (VR/AR) technologies are transforming the way tenants interact with properties. VR tours allow prospective tenants to visualize properties remotely, while AR applications can overlay property information onto the physical world, enhancing the real estate process.
